The Role

As Marine Mechanic Apprentice at Grand Harbour Marina, you will work alongside our Chief Marine Engineer in the Marine Service Shop, developing your skills across the full scope of marine engine service, diagnostics, and repair on a diverse fleet of inboard, outboard, and stern drive engines. You will assist with routine service and maintenance, progress to more complex diagnostics and repair work as your skills develop, and receive active support for OEM certification training with Mercury, Volvo Penta, and Yamaha.

This is a full-time position with a benefits package, a structured path for skill development and certification, and the opportunity to grow into a fully qualified marine technician as the marina’s service department expands. Mercury Marine and Volvo Penta certification are strong assets for the full-time role. Yamaha certification is also highly valued and is particularly relevant during the seasonal peak period.

Key Responsibilities Engine Service & Routine Maintenance
  • Assist Chief Marine Engineer with scheduled service and preventative maintenance on inboard, outboard, and stern drive marine engines including oil and filter changes, impeller replacement, gear oil service, fuel filter replacement, spark plug service, and belt and hose inspection
  • Perform pre-season commissioning and post-season winterization of engines and marine mechanical systems under the supervision and direction of senior technicians
  • Assist with the flushing, fogging, and protective treatment of engine systems during lay‑up and recommissioning procedures
  • Inspect, lubricate, and service steering systems, throttle and shift cables, trim tabs, power tilt and trim systems, and related mechanical components
  • Assist with propeller removal, inspection, installation, and basic propeller damage assessment
  • Maintain accurate and complete service records, work orders, and parts used documentation for every job on the Shop Management System
  • Assist senior technicians with engine diagnostics using OEM diagnostic software and tools including Mercury’s CDS/Vessel View Mobile, Volvo Penta VODIA, Yamaha Diagnostic System (YDS), and equivalent dealer-level diagnostic platforms
  • Learn to interpret fault codes, live data readings, and diagnostic test results under the guidance of senior technicians, building diagnostic competency progressively over time
  • Assist with the removal, repair, and reinstallation of engine components including fuel systems, cooling systems, electrical systems, ignition systems, and lower unit assemblies as directed
  • Assist with the diagnosis and repair of marine electrical systems including battery systems, charging circuits, bilge pump systems, navigation lighting, and onboard 12V and 24V DC systems
